I'm having problems with the <mark duplicates>-<mark on property>-<folder path> utility.

I am using expert mode. I am searching for e-books. I get a number of results including in my downloads directory.

I use <folder path> to try to mark those found items in my downloads folder. It looks to me that I've entered this correctly. However the process ends up with a "no matching paths" result.

backslashes in the path are considered regular expression markers, so try entering TWO slashes instead \\ to escape
